A Happy Meal and a Heart Full of Sorrow

After a long day, I stopped by McDonald’s to grab a quick bite. As I waited for my order, I noticed a woman walk in with her little daughter. Their clothes were worn, and the mother’s thin coat looked barely warm, but the girl’s wide eyes lit up at the menu above the counter.

They ordered a single cheeseburger and small fries. When the girl shyly asked for the toy, her mother hesitated and said gently, “Maybe next time.” The girl nodded without complaint, leaning against her mother as if she understood more than a child her age should.

Something about the moment tugged at me. When my number was called, I quietly returned to the counter and asked the cashier to add a Happy Meal to their order—anonymously. I watched from my seat as the girl spotted the box, her face glowing with pure joy. “Mommy, look! They gave me a toy!” she squealed.

Her mother looked around, confused but grateful, her shoulders relaxing as her daughter giggled over her meal.

I left feeling lighter than I had all day. It wasn’t much—just a small gesture. But sometimes, a touch of unexpected kindness is enough to make the world feel a little softer for someone who needs it.
